5 May 2026 – Thales Alenia Space announces the signing of a €26.1 million phase 1 contract with the European Space Agency (ESA) related to the development of LISA’s telescopes. Made up of three satellites, the LISA (Laser Interferometer Space Antenna) mission will be the first European space observatory capable of detecting and studying gravitational waves generated by extreme cosmic events. This latest announcement follows the signing of two other contracts related to the same mission. In June 2025, Thales Alenia Space announced a contract with prime contractor OHB System AG to provide several critical elements, including the spacecraft avionics and control software, the telecommunication system, and the drag-free and attitude control system (DFACS).
